Join the Team at the Vancouver Rowing Club!



Founded in 1886, the

Vancouver Rowing Club (VRC)

is proud to be the city's oldest amateur athletics club. With over a century of history, our members are actively engaged in

Rowing, Rugby, Field Hockey, and Yachting

. Nestled in the heart of

Stanley Park with stunning Coal Harbour views

, our heritage clubhouse and marina offer a one-of-a-kind setting for sports, community, and social connection.
